Redeeming Your Codes

Redeeming codes in Shonen Smash is straightforward:

  1. Launch Shonen Smash.
  2. Access the menu (usually a button on the left).
  3. Enter the code into the designated box.
  4. Press Enter. A notification confirms successful redemption.
